Output 6693b50e71a65930678ecdc34733c6434498bd2ec9d4b5cc618b3714475d40f8:21

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ce04fc58f255ff9b5a2f70b719c2235c8cb77857 OP_EQUAL
address
ABDbqKbxiKQG57wTwD633SEZRXVMUmgkbb
transaction
6693b50e71a65930678ecdc34733c6434498bd2ec9d4b5cc618b3714475d40f8